Output 26f8f6863688cc39d80df65a4c52a5af74d83970f6c4e68176f6160bc2de94a3:1

value
29879259
script pubkey
OP_0 OP_PUSHBYTES_20 fb061cf7bcb024aa5a5d25a9b667e71ab6129f46
address
bc1qlvrpeaaukqj25kjayk5mvel8r2mp986xy6l98m
transaction
26f8f6863688cc39d80df65a4c52a5af74d83970f6c4e68176f6160bc2de94a3
spent
true